2012-03-19 6 views
0

DetailsView 컨트롤에서 드롭 다운 목록을 만들었습니다.세부 정보보기 컨트롤에서 여러 열 드롭 다운

드롭 다운 목록에 여러 개의 열이 있어야합니다. 그게 가능하니? 그렇다면 어떻게? 많은 검색을했는데 해결 방법을 찾지 못하는 것 같습니다. 다음은

내 드롭 템플릿 코드입니다 :

<asp:TemplateField HeaderText="Division" SortExpression="fDivisionID"> 
        <EditItemTemplate> 
         <asp:DropDownList 
          ID="DivisionDropDownList" 
          runat="server" 
          DataSourceID="DivisionSqlDataSource" 
          DataTextField="DivisionName" 
          DataValueField="DivisionID" 
          Text='<%# Bind("fDivisionID") %>'> 
         </asp:DropDownList> 
        </EditItemTemplate> 

        <ItemTemplate> 
         <asp:Label ID="Label1" runat="server" Text='<%# Bind("DivisionName") %>'></asp:Label> 
        </ItemTemplate> 
       </asp:TemplateField> 

내가 그에게 다른 열을 추가하려면 어떻게 .. 예 : "위치".. 있습니다

답변

0

사전에

감사 등 실제로 세 가지 방법이 있다고 생각합니다.

  1. 아래와 같이 데이터베이스에서 페치 할 때 Select 문에 두 개의 열을 추가하십시오. 또는 here

    선택 열 1 + ''+ 열 2에서

  2. Yourtable

    에서 당신은 타사 컨트롤을 사용할 수 있습니다.

  3. JQuery와 또한이 기능 Here

+0

이 그것을 다른 컨트롤을 사용하는 것입니다 지원 ... 그것이 DataView를 제어 범위 내에서 실시 할 수 있습니까? – vitalix

+0

고마워. 나는 다른 길을 가고 새로운 분야를 만들고 거기에 필요한 것을 결합하여 사용했다. detailsview 컨트롤에서 수행 할 수없는 것은 무엇입니까? – vitalix

+0

드롭 다운 목록에서 텍스트를 추가하거나 위에서 언급 한 다른 옵션을 사용하여 여러 열을 표시 할 수 있습니다. – Pankaj

관련 문제